Sat 1577258733038176

decimal
421806.1233038176
degree
0°1806′462″1233038176‴
percentile
40.02800444849131%
name
psfefzkwywn
cycle
0
epoch
2
period
209
block
421806
offset
1233038176
timestamp
rarity
common